Output fdda82b8e290c756fb942f4b792c3b2851f3d190a43a38809a34beb81a25cbb3:17

value
64301
script pubkey
OP_0 OP_PUSHBYTES_20 0514ecbfbf4b376009b324d5c53b716e7586eb54
address
bc1qq52we0alfvmkqzdnyn2u2wm3de6cd665prw3vw
transaction
fdda82b8e290c756fb942f4b792c3b2851f3d190a43a38809a34beb81a25cbb3